ECQ-E1124KF Equivalent & Substitute Parts
Part Overview
The ECQ-E1124KF is a 0.12 µF film capacitor rated for 100V DC operation with ±10% tolerance, manufactured by Panasonic Electronic Components. This radial through-hole component uses polyester metallized dielectric technology and operates across a temperature range of -40°C to 105°C. The product is currently obsolete, making identification of functionally equivalent alternatives necessary for ongoing system maintenance and repair applications.
Substiute Parts
Key Parameters
| Parameter | Value |
|---|---|
| Capacitance | 0.12 µF |
| Tolerance | ±10% |
| Voltage Rating - DC | 100V |
| Dielectric Material | Polyester, Metallized |
| Mounting Type | Through Hole |
| Package / Case | Radial |
| Operating Temperature Range | -40°C ~ 105°C |
| Termination | PC Pins |
Substitute Part Grouping Explanation
Substitution of the ECQ-E1124KF is determined by strict equivalence across the following critical parameters:
- Capacitance Value: 0.12 µF (exact match required)
- Tolerance: ±10% (exact match required)
- Voltage Rating - DC: 100V minimum (equal or higher acceptable)
- Dielectric Material: Polyester, Metallized (exact match required)
- Mounting Type: Through Hole (exact match required)
- Package / Case: Radial (exact match required)
- Termination: PC Pins (exact match required)
The BFC237121124 from Vishay Beyschlag/Draloric/BC Components meets all substitution criteria. This part maintains identical capacitance, tolerance, DC voltage rating, dielectric composition, mounting configuration, and termination style. Physical dimensions and lead spacing remain within acceptable tolerance for direct board-level replacement.
Parameter Comparison
| Parameter | ECQ-E1124KF (Panasonic) | BFC237121124 (Vishay) | Compatibility |
|---|---|---|---|
| Capacitance | 0.12 µF | 0.12 µF | Exact Match |
| Tolerance | ±10% | ±10% | Exact Match |
| Voltage Rating - DC | 100V | 100V | Exact Match |
| Voltage Rating - AC | - | 63V | Not Applicable to Main Part |
| Dielectric Material | Polyester, Metallized | Polyester, Metallized | Exact Match |
| Operating Temperature Range | -40°C ~ 105°C | -55°C ~ 105°C | Substitute Exceeds Range |
| Mounting Type | Through Hole | Through Hole | Exact Match |
| Package / Case | Radial | Radial | Exact Match |
| Size / Dimension | 0.406" L x 0.177" W (10.30mm x 4.50mm) | 0.394" L x 0.157" W (10.00mm x 4.00mm) | Physically Similar |
| Height - Seated (Max) | 0.335" (8.50mm) | 0.354" (9.00mm) | Physically Similar |
| Lead Spacing | 0.295" (7.50mm) | 0.300" (7.62mm) | Physically Similar |
| Termination | PC Pins | PC Pins | Exact Match |
| Product Status | Obsolete | Active | Substitute Available |
| RoHS Status | Not Specified | ROHS3 Compliant | Substitute Compliant |
Engineering Selection Recommendations
The BFC237121124 is a direct functional equivalent for the obsolete ECQ-E1124KF. Both components share identical electrical specifications across capacitance, tolerance, DC voltage rating, and dielectric material. The substitute part is currently in active production status with 955 units available in inventory, ensuring supply continuity for repair and maintenance applications.
The BFC237121124 provides an extended operating temperature range (-55°C to 105°C versus -40°C to 105°C), which represents an operational advantage in low-temperature environments. Physical dimensions are within acceptable tolerance for standard through-hole PCB mounting. The substitute part carries ROHS3 compliance certification, meeting current environmental and regulatory standards.
Lead spacing of 0.300" (7.62mm) on the substitute part is functionally equivalent to the original 0.295" (7.50mm) specification for standard 0.3" pitch PCB layouts. Height and length variations remain within acceptable mechanical tolerances for direct board-level substitution without design modification.
